We had the same problem with our Hoover Agility SteamVac and the problem was the fan that turns the gears that then turns the brushes was corroded (rusted) and thus completely frozen up! My husband had to take apart the vacuum unit in front of the motor to figure this out. THE SOLUTION: He put WD40 on the main axel/wheel thingy! The tricky part? Getting the unit put back together right! But it worked!

Most likely the brushes are full of lint and can no longer rotate. If you have a hoover, you can pull the brush assemble out (it's held in by plastic clips) and separate the housing. This will allow you to pull all the accumulated lint out.
